Latest Patents
Among her latest patents is a groundbreaking design for a projective capacitive touch panel with suppressed capacitance coupling in corners. This touch panel comprises first and second arrays of electrodes along with an output part that connects to external devices. Interestingly, Kitahara's design features corner electrodes that have a reduced area compared to other end electrodes, enhancing functionality and user experience.
Another notable patent is for an electromagnetic relay that includes a fixed contact part, a movable contact part, an armature, an electromagnet, and a base. This innovative design allows for the movable contact to engage with the fixed contact depending on the generated magnetic field, an advancement that enhances the reliability of electromagnetic switches.
